6.2
Output voltage load regulation
Primary output load regulation
Figure 20 shows negligible primary output voltage variation (normalized to the value measured at IOUT = 0 A) over
the entire output current range for the L6983I with VOUTprim = 5 V.
Figure 20. Load regulation of the primary not isolated output voltage (VIN = 12 V, VOUT_prim = 5 V, fSW = 400
kHz)
Secondary output load regulation
Since there is no regulation loop involving the secondary output, its load regulation depends, to some extent,
on the primary load regulation and is affected by the leakage inductance (see Figure 22) of the transformer,
the voltage drops across to the Schottky diode (diode forward voltage) and the DCR of the secondary coil, as
indicated by the equation (Eq. (1)) (where only the last two contributions are considered). Minimizing all the
mentioned parameters leads to a better load regulation.
As shown in Section 6.1 , the input voltage also plays a role in the isolated output regulation, as depicted by
Figure 21.
